Course: Blue Rock Golf Course (Executive Par 3)

Location: South Yarmouth, MA

Fairway Conditions: 8
Being a par-3 course, this is not really applicable on most holes, but where there is a fairway, they were very green, thick and plush. No disease was spotted on the entire course. The grass was a bit long.

Greens Conditions: 7
Greens read true and the ball rolled good. No disease and the seemed to recover well from weather and wear and tear. They did seem a soft and rolled slow. Greens could be mowed shorter. Come prepared with a divot tool, because many balls will either plug or make larger divots.

Scenery: 6
Beautiful layout overlooking holes 3, 9, 10 and 18. No real great views otherwise. Some holes play alongside housing.

Difficulty of Course: 8
Very challenging course and you will use all of your irons and even metals. Some holes are real short, but very deceiving. Long holes are also scattered throughout. Wind plays a major factor in club selection here. Water and traps are in play on the majority of holes. This is a great course to hone your iron skills.

Value Received: 7
Pretty expensive for even a great par-3. $38 for 18, but a $5 discount can be negotiated for larger groups. Be sure to ask for the $5 coupon for your next round. 9-hole deal including breakfast.

Speed of Play/Design of Course: 7
Spread out nicely with longer walks between shorter holes. Course policy is to wait for group ahead of you to tee off of hole 2 before starting your round.
